Types of Welder’s Certificates
Although the AWS’ normal CW (Certified Welder) card helps make you eligible for most employment opportunities, some fields require their specific certification. Several of the most-popular of which are highlighted below.
- American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for those that deal with boiler and pressure containers
- Certified Welder Certificates to be a Certified Welder
- American Petroleum Institute Certification for those who work on pipelines in the oil and gas field
- Certified Welding Instructor and Senior Certified Welding Instructor Certifications for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ors

A Look Inside Welding Programs
The following suggestions should certainly help assist you in deciding which welding schools will be the right fit for your situation. Selecting welding specialist programs might seem easy, yet you need to ensure that that you’re picking the best kind of program. To make sure you won’t be losing your time and your money, it is vital to make certain the school you’ve decided on is actually authorized by the American Welding Society. Soon after verifying the accreditation status, you need to explore a little bit further to be certain that the training program you like can offer you the correct training.
- Attempt to find classes that comply with AWS SENSE standards
- Make certain the college trains on tools that matches up-to-date industry guidelines
- Find out if the school provides financial support
- You should make sure the school’s program provides you with courses in pipe welding, GTAW, GMAW, and SMAW
